How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 91010?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 91010 Studio Apartments | $2,473 | $1,900 | $2,890 |
| 91010 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,785 | $1,875 | $3,942 |
| 91010 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,471 | $2,548 | $4,253 |
| 91010 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,194 | $4,054 | $4,614 |
| 91010 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,994 | $3,845 | $5,906 |

Frequently Asked Questions about the 91010 ZIP Code
How much are Studio apartments in 91010?
There are currently 38 Studio Apartments in 91010 with rent ranges from $1,900 to $2,890 with an average price of $2,473.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om 91010 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 91010 ranges from $1,875 to $3,942 with an average monthly rent of $2,785.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 91010 c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 91010 range from $2,548 to $4,253.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,471.
